About

Sheng Ma is a scholar working on Immunology, Biomedical Engineering and Oncology. According to data from OpenAlex, Sheng Ma has authored 50 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Immunology, 14 papers in Biomedical Engineering and 12 papers in Oncology. Recurrent topics in Sheng Ma's work include Immunotherapy and Immune Responses (12 papers), Nanoplatforms for cancer theranostics (12 papers) and Cancer Immunotherapy and Biomarkers (9 papers). Sheng Ma is often cited by papers focused on Immunotherapy and Immune Responses (12 papers), Nanoplatforms for cancer theranostics (12 papers) and Cancer Immunotherapy and Biomarkers (9 papers). Sheng Ma collaborates with scholars based in China, United States and Australia. Sheng Ma's co-authors include Wantong Song, Zhaohui Tang, Xinghui Si, Yudi Xu, Xuesi Chen, Jiayu Zhao, Zichao Huang, Yu Zhang, Shixian Lv and Haochen Yao and has published in prestigious journals such as Advanced Materials, Nano Letters and ACS Nano.
